November 26, 2007 - LES MÉLODÎNES AT PLACE DES ARTS - Three concerts in December?one of them free!

Montreal, November 26, 2007 – Pro Musica and Place des Arts is setting the table for a harmonious holiday season as the fifth edition of LES MÉLODÎNES continues on Thursdays from 12:10 to 12:50 p.m. Three enchanting concerts are scheduled: baritone Charles Prévost and pianist Francis Perron on December 6; bayan accordionist Vladimir Sidorov on December 13; and the vocal ensemble Modulation performing Christmas songs on December 20. Thursday, December 6 from 12:10 to 12:50 p.m. at the Studio-théâtre of Place des Arts
All the delicacy and refinement of a bygone era will be recaptured in the program presented by baritone Charles Prévost and pianist Francis Perron. In the 1960s, under the name of Charles Linton, Charles Prévost was a member of the legendary group Les Sinners. He went on to study the vocal arts, developing an exceptional voice. A great technician of the piano and versatile artist, Francis Perron has long performed as a chamber musician and accompanist with some of the country’s most prestigious ensembles. The two artists will charm the lunch crowd with the music of Gounod, Hahn, Fauré, Duparc, Ravel and Prévost.

Thursday, December 13 from 12:10 to 12:50 p.m. at the Studio-théâtre of Place des Arts
In the hands of a virtuoso like Vladimir Sidorov, the bayan accordion is suited to all repertoires, from folk to classical music. The bayan is a chromatic button accordion developed in Russia in the early 20th century. Its internal construction gives the instrument a different tone colour from western accordions, with fuller bass sounds in particular. Its range and purity of tone make it the instrument of choice for both the classical and contemporary repertoire. Vladimir Sidorov will here demonstrate his talent and finesse with works by Chopin, Vlasov, Gridin, Liadov, as well as traditional Russian music and some of his own compositions.

Thursday, December 20 from 12:10 to 12:50 p.m. at the Hall des Pas perdus – Free Concert  In their third year at LESMÉLODÎNES, the female vocal ensemble Modulation, under the musical direction of Lucie Roy, will celebrate Christmas in festive style. Formed in 1991 with the aim of promoting the rich repertoire of religious and secular a cappella works, Modulation performs regularly at the country’s major choral events, in addition to gracing a number of Quebec film soundtracks. The ensemble will perform A Ceremony Of Carols by Benjamin Britten, along with such Christmas favourites as Jingle Bells, White Christmas and Bonhomme Hiver.
